Historically, coffee has often been viewed with suspicion. Its stimulating properties, attributed to caffeine, have led to concerns about potential negative effects on heart health, such as increased heart rate and elevated blood pressure. However, recent research challenges these assumptions, suggesting that moderate coffee consumption might not be as harmful as once thought. In fact, some studies propose that coffee could offer protective benefits against certain heart conditions.

One of the key points highlighted is the wealth of research suggesting that moderate coffee consumption can be associated with a reduced risk of various heart conditions. Studies have shown that the antioxidants and bioactive compounds present in coffee contribute positively to heart health by reducing inflammation and improving cholesterol levels. Additionally, the habitual enjoyment of coffee may enhance metabolic function, which in turn supports cardiovascular wellness.

Moreover, we delved into the specific components of coffee, such as caffeine, which, despite its sometimes controversial reputation, has been shown to offer protective benefits when consumed in moderation. Research underscores that caffeine can improve endothelial function and increase fat oxidation, thus playing a crucial role in heart health.

It’s equally important to recognize the variations in individual responses to coffee consumption, influenced by genetic factors and lifestyle. This underscores the need for personalized approaches when considering coffee’s place in your diet. By understanding these nuances, individuals can tailor their coffee consumption to maximize health benefits while minimizing potential risks.
